What companies run services between Genève-Cornavin Station, Switzerland and Confiserie Sprüngli, Switzerland?

Swiss Federal Railways (SBB CFF FFS) operates a train from Genève to Zürich HB hourly. Tickets cost CHF 50–100 and the journey takes 2h 53m. Alternatively, FlixBus operates a bus from Geneva to Zurich Bus Station 5 times a day. Tickets cost CHF 21–30 and the journey takes 3h 45m. RegioJet also services this route once a week.
